The shims are of a hard materials- tempered STEEL , they are also rarely damaged unless run DRY, when a job is done by a qulaified Honda service dept ( hum, an oxy moron) they subsitutite your shims for others that will allow proper clearances. remember its the valves and head that wear and rockers.
